Ringside Update/ Gervonta Davis Mayweather’s New ‘Money’

*As I begin this edition about this young boxing sensation who hails out of Baltimore, Maryland, I can’t help but to think of whom this fighter reminds me so much of.

There are so many to chose from but who really stands out to me is “Iron” Mike Tyson. And folks, the reason why is because Gervonta Davis is short, and compact with power, and speed. And anybody that could knock you out with a body shot, is very dangerous indeed.

He’s had over 200 amateur fights before turning professional, so he had enough experience before he got into the big stage. And since turning pro he has accumulated a very impressive ring record of 21-0 with 20 coming by way of knockout. And he’s only 24 years old.

He’s a two time super featherweight champion now currently holding the WBA title and if any of you missed his fight last weekend that was telecast live on Showtime Championship Boxing you really missed something special because he stopped Hugo Ruiz at 2:59 in the first round by TKO.

It hasn’t been an easy upbringing for this young man after going in and out of foster homes and dealing with the rough and gritty life of the streets Sand-Town Winchester section of Baltimore, Maryland, he was able to find an escape from all of what he was going through by being in the boxing gym. His trainer and mentor is none other than Calvin Ford who has given him the right leadership and mentoring that he continues to provide.

He is now one of Floyd “Money” Mayweather’s top tier fighters or what this writer considers new “Money” and he is set to go farther in the boxing stratosphere under Mayweather Promotions.

There’s whispers around the sport that he ‘s ready to take on Vasyl Lamachenko and or even Mikey Garcia two of the other world champion fighters in that weight division. As I always say, we’ll see what happens. In the meantime, keep your eyes on this kid because he’s dangerous folks.

In other boxing news, Anthony Joshua is set to go against “Big baby” Miller in a championship bout that will be held at Madison Square Garden on June 1 with his WBA, IBF, WBO, and IBO titles all on the line and we’re all looking forward to seeing that one go down.
